S. 1213 - Weatherization Enhancement, and Local Energy Efficiency Investment and Accountability Act

Energy. 113th Congress (2013-2014) View bill details
Sponsor:
Summary:
A bill to reauthorize the weatherization and State energy programs, and for other purposes. (by CRS) 
Status:
The bill has been referred to committee. 
There have been no votes on this bill.

ActionDateDescription
Introduced6/20/2013
6/20/2013Read twice and referred to the Committee on Energy and Natural Resources.
6/20/2013Introduced in Senate
6/25/2013Committee on Energy and Natural Resources Subcommittee on Energy. Hearings held. With printed Hearing: S.Hrg. 113-70.
